+1596.00
Рейтинг
210.98
Сила

Arris

^.^ 27 декабря 2018, 08:21
  • avatar Arris
  • 7
Только тогда надо таки разделить карму за посты и карму за комментарии.

За посты: рейтинг полезности
За комменты: рейтинг… я даже не знаю, какое слово тут лучше подобрать :( дискуссионности? (обращаюсь к тебе как к лингвисту ;) )

И именно рейтинг полезности позволяет писать или не писать в публичных блогах.
  • avatar Arris
  • 1
Это одно и то же. Это оценка. Оценка анонимная или нет. И только-то.

А все остальное — личное отношение к оценке, уровень самокритики. У кого-то лучше, у кого-то хуже.

*Аррис медитирует*
  • avatar Arris
  • 2
Мнение можно выразить неанонимным комментарием, где и изложить замечания по существу.
Можно. Но делать это, как правило, лень. И проще влепить минус.

«Не читал, но осуждаю»
  • avatar Arris
  • 2
Добавлю к словам Фланнана: тред был про логику в ролевых играх. Фланнан выступал на стороне логики.
  • avatar Arris
  • 5
Пришёл, начал постить ненужное
Ненужное кому?

Всему ролевому сообществу? Ну так у нас слишком маленький контингент, чтобы можно было назвать его «всем ролевым сообществом». Было бы у нас человек 600 (активно читающих и пишущих) — тогда да, карма уже начинала бы как-то роллять.

Ненужное маленькой тусовке «элиты»? А какое отношение эта элита имеет к «ролевому сообществу»? Только то, что она в него входит, но отнюдь не формирует!

Так что читать твои слова приходится так:

" Пришёл, начал постить ненужное маленькой группе людей"
Вот в чем беда то. В том, что народу слишком мало, чтобы карма работала адекватно (хабру).

Проблема в том, что кроме «температуры по больнице» в случае деанонимизации, могут возникать личные претензии к минусующим/плюсующим оппонента.
Она и без всякой деанонимизации возникает :)

А вот в случае деанонимизации она, как ни странно, лечится.«Я с ним пообщался в реале. Ну нормальный же человек, правда пишет в интернете всякую фигню… ну так и ресурс, если вдуматься...».
  • avatar Arris
  • 3
Надеюсь, к твоим словам прислушаются ;)
  • avatar Arris
  • 3
Да, ты кругом прав ;)
Предложение было неразумным.
  • avatar Arris
  • -5
Ну да, Декк, Крашер, было.

А вам что, так приятно копаться в грязном белье? Нет, чё, реально приятно?
  • avatar Arris
  • 3
Я имел в виду немного другое.
Вот на 00:01 28 июня у Васи Пупкина +10 кармы.

Предположим, у нас голос за комментарий по прежнему меняет карму на 0.1, а голос за топик на 1.

Васю начинают минусовать и он набирает в сумме 200 минусов к 17:00.

В нынешней механике кармы от улетает в ридонли уже в 17:00
А если карма обновляется раз в сутки — то он до 23:59:59 имеет свои условные +10 кармы, а ровно в полночь его карма пересчитывается и он выпадает из дискуссии нахрен, имея свои -10 рейтинга.

Что-то такое я имел в виду.
  • avatar Arris
  • 3
публичные топики «почему ты меня не любишь азаза???!!!»?
*фыркнул*
Первый же такой топик соберет -40 в рейтинг.
  • avatar Arris
  • 5
Ты конечно в чём то прав, но я все равно предвижу злоупотребления.

Если чем-то можно злоупотребить — рано или поздно этим обязательно злоупотребят. Это не закон Мерфи, это жизненное наблюдение.
  • avatar Arris
  • 3
Может быть просто карму обновлять раз в сутки? :)
То есть реальный уровень кармы вычисляется (и обновляется) раз в сутки на основании оценок.

Хотя это сложновато в реализации. Возни много.
  • avatar Arris
  • 5
И кстати, напрямую смыкающееся с кармой предложение:

По хорошему — надо переделать плагин игнора:

Так, чтобы ты не видел того, кого заигнорил. Не видел совсем. И, соответственно, не мог ему ставить ни плюсы, ни минусы.

А то интересно получается — «Я его заигнорил, но осуждаю и оцениваю».

Так вы определитесь — вы его игнорите или оцениваете? :)

Ну и чтобы тебя действительно НЕ видели заигнорившие тебя, а не как обычно.
А то какое-то нарушение логики :)
  • avatar Arris
  • 3
Единственное, почему я этого ещё не сделал — не хочу срачиков от людей типа Арриса и криков про «имкомафию».
Я же уже объяснил!!!

Как я уже говорил, если я увижу, что какой-то хмырь тупо минусует КАЖДЫЙ мой комментарий (а таки есть, да) — ну и что с ним обсуждать? Спрашивать «почто ты меня минусуешь?». Да я и так знаю.

При этом я могу спокойно «вычесть» из реальной оценки его минус и смотреть — а кто же действительно несогласен, а не поставил минус по аватарке/нику.
  • avatar Arris
  • 4
А если кто-то не хочет — он может посещать такой «скрытый» блог и продолжать минусовать. То есть, собственно, это и не решение, а так, оттягивание конца.
  • avatar Arris
  • 5
если её будет видно, то в этом «ридонли» не будет смысла, а если её видно не будет
Её не будет видно в общей ленте, но может быть видно в блоке «прямой эфир» или через отдельное меню «Песочница» (куда автоматом агрегируются топики из личных блогов тех, кто… «ридонли»)
  • avatar Arris
  • 6
Разрешить с отрицательной кармой писать в своем бложике (и топики и комменты), если твоя карма ниже 0 — то пост никогда не попадает на главную и по-умолчанию серенько так скрыт.
Хомяк не совсем корректно процитировал мое предложение :(

Ушел в ридонли — можешь писать только в личный блог, при этом твои посты не отображаются в общей ленте.

При этом ты тебе нельзя поставить минус(*) к топику, только плюс или «воздержался».
(*) очевидно зачем: чтобы у человека оставался шанс выйти из «заминусованного» состояния. То есть он сидит в «хайде» и его карму его активность не ухудшает
  • avatar Arris
  • 6
Нужно. Готовых плагинов нет, придётся писать свой. Но сделать надо.

В свое время для форума нашли интересное решение: при регистрации пользователь заполняет пару нестандартных полей:
— своя таймзона (и по умолчанию там стоит -13 GMT)
— свой день рожденья (и по умолчанию там можно поставить какой-нибудь совсем неправильный год из будущего)

А дальше социнженерия: боты игнорируют эти два поля и оставляют значения по умолчанию. В итоге ботом считается существо, хоть и подтвердившее емейл, но родившееся в будущем году и имеющее таймзону -13 GMT.
  • avatar Arris
  • 3
Коммуниздию:

Предлагаю просто в верстке шаблона поменять порядок полей.

Файл /templates/skin/synio/comment.tpl, 63 строка, новый вид:

<div class="vote-down" onclick="return ls.vote.vote({$oComment->getId()},this,-1,'comment');"></div>

<span class="vote-count" id="vote_total_comment_{$oComment->getId()}">{if $oComment->getRating() > 0}+{/if}{$oComment->getRating()}</span>

<div class="vote-up" onclick="return ls.vote.vote({$oComment->getId()},this,1,'comment');"></div>


"-" оценка "+"
  • avatar Arris
  • 6
Тем не менее предложение набрало 21 "+" в сумме. Правда не менее интересно, сколько же оно набрало конкретно плюсов и минусов…